Output e34bdb56df4d00d3097f44c021451aa00effd45cb8f1fa4832df60bc9690602b:0

value
632053
script pubkey
OP_0 OP_PUSHBYTES_32 926eec435e1c801ea687fc4c76b344a4fd764c5ae0342e11a73e7480cd492f01
address
bc1qjfhwcs67rjqpaf58l3x8dv6y5n7hvnz6uq6zuyd88e6gpn2f9uqsr8gt6j
transaction
e34bdb56df4d00d3097f44c021451aa00effd45cb8f1fa4832df60bc9690602b
spent
true